What do you do when you've started trusting what you can count more than the God who provides?
In this powerful message from 2 Samuel 24:24, we're challenged to examine the difference between ownership and stewardship. Through the story of David's census, we discover how easy it is to place our confidence in resources, accomplishments, numbers, and visible security rather than in God's faithfulness.
This sermon explores the danger of a calculator mentality, the power of authentic worship, and why David refused to offer God something that cost him nothing. You'll learn how worship is not a transaction to earn God's favor but a response to the mercy He's already extended.
Whether you're navigating uncertainty, carrying the weight of responsibility, or struggling to trust God beyond what you can see, this message will remind you that some of the greatest breakthroughs happen when you stop counting what you have and start honoring the One who gave it to you.
Listen with an open heart and discover why the cost of your offering often reveals the condition of your trust.
